PHP+MySQL珠联璧合 老情人一样给力
情人节到了,先祝大家情人节快乐!那什么是 Web开发技术最给力的情人组合呢?个人觉得当属PHP+MySQL. PHP是功能强大的服务器端脚本语言,;MySQL并发能力强、响应速度快,是性能优异的数据库软件。PHP和MySQL都能在所有主流操作系统和许多非主流系统中运行。珠联璧合使开发者大笑江湖。
低成本
PHP是一种服务器端脚本语言,它是专门为Web而设计的。PHP是一种HTML内嵌式的语言,是一种在服务器端执行的嵌入HTML文档的脚本语言,语言的风格有类似于C语言,被广泛的运用。和其它技术相比,PHP本身免费。PHP是一个开放源代码的产品,这就意味着,你可以访问其源代码,也可以免费使用、修改并且再次发布。
MySQL是世界上最受欢迎的开源数据库,已经多次获得《Linux Journal》杂志的读者选择奖。在开放源代码许可下,MySQL是免费的,而在商业许可下,MySQL也只需要很少的费用。所以使用PHP+MySQL可使中小型网站为了降低网站总体拥有成本,自然而然也成了主流的开发模式,也广受开发者喜欢。
推荐阅读:PHP,最流行的Web开发语言
速度快
PHP的快捷性较好,程序开发快,运行快,技术本身学习快。可嵌入HTML:因为PHP可以嵌入HTML语言,它相对于其他语言,编辑简单,实用性强,更适合初学者。而MySQL本事体积小,速度也是相当的更力。只要PHP代码没有死循环或者过多的大负载循环,做好MySQL数据库的优化,无论在Windows 或者 linux 使用PHP+Mysql都比ASP.NET+Mssql快。
推荐阅读:
- PHP中数组插入MySQL表的方法
- PHP开发中MySQL表单提交防止重复刷新的实现
PHP连接MySQL很简单
其实PHP连接MySQL是一件非常简单的事情,但是我们必须注意的是编码问题 ,编码不正确将会导致乱码问题。
连接数据库代码如下:
代码
<$link=MySQL_connect("localhost","root","123") or die("connect to database failed"); $result=MySQL_query("create database trampt") or die("query failed"); MySQL_select_db("trampt"); MySQL_query("set names UTF8"); $result=MySQL_query("create table Users (userid int auto_increment primary key,username varchar(50),password varchar(50))") or die("query failed"); MySQL_query("insert into users (username,password) values('51CTO','123')") or die("insert record failed"); MySQL_close($link); ?>
读取数据库代码如下:
< require("inc/conn.php"); $result=MySQL_query("select * from users"); while($ob=MySQL_fetch_object($result)) { echo "user name is : ".$ob->username." "; } MySQL_close($link); ?>
PHP+MySQL最佳案例分享
PHP+MySQL+jQuery实现发布微博程序——PHP篇